Understanding the Core Technology Behind Voice-Controlled Blinds
Before diving into specific features, it’s crucial to understand how voice commands actually translate to physical blind movement. The process involves three core components working in harmony: the voice assistant (which interprets your speech), the smart hub (which processes commands and manages protocols), and the blind motor controller (which executes the physical movement). In 2026, most systems use either direct Wi-Fi connectivity, low-power mesh networks like Thread, or bridge devices that translate between protocols. The key is understanding that your voice assistant’s capabilities are only as good as the hub’s ability to communicate with your specific blind motors.
The Role of Edge Computing in Response Time
Modern systems increasingly process voice commands locally rather than in the cloud. This edge computing approach reduces latency from seconds to milliseconds, meaning your blinds respond almost instantaneously. Look for hubs that advertise on-device processing for common commands, especially if you plan to integrate multiple rooms or complex scenes.
Key Features to Evaluate in 2026 Voice Assistants
Not all voice assistants are created equal when it comes to controlling window treatments. The baseline functionality—opening and closing—has become table stakes. The real differentiators lie in advanced features that enhance daily use.
Natural Language Processing Capabilities
The best assistants in 2026 understand contextual commands like “make it darker in here” or “open the blinds halfway until 3 PM.” They recognize room-specific requests without explicit naming and can interpret vague temporal instructions. Evaluate whether an assistant supports follow-up questions and can maintain conversation context across multiple commands.
Multi-User Recognition and Personalization
Households with multiple occupants need assistants that distinguish between voices and apply personalized preferences. Your “open the blinds” might mean fully open, while your partner’s same command might trigger 70% open based on their saved preferences. Advanced systems even factor in individual schedules, adjusting blinds differently for each person based on their typical departure times.
Offline Functionality and Local Processing
Internet outages shouldn’t leave you manually tugging at smart blinds. Premium assistants offer robust offline modes where basic commands still work via local network processing. This is particularly important for blinds, which are essential for privacy and light control. Ask about the command vocabulary available offline versus cloud-connected.
Smart Hub Compatibility: The Foundation of Your Setup
Your hub serves as the central nervous system, and its compatibility determines everything else. In 2026, the hub landscape has consolidated around a few key architectures, but important distinctions remain.
Protocol Support: Matter, Zigbee, Z-Wave, and Wi-Fi 6E
Matter has finally delivered on its interoperability promise, but legacy protocols still matter. A future-ready hub should support Matter over Thread natively while maintaining bridges for older Zigbee and Z-Wave blind motors. Wi-Fi 6E support ensures your hub won’t become a bottleneck as you add more devices, with dedicated 6 GHz backhaul preventing interference from streaming services and other network traffic.
Hub Ecosystem Lock-in vs. Interoperability
Some manufacturers design hubs that work best within their own ecosystem, offering deeper integration at the cost of flexibility. Others prioritize openness. Consider your long-term smart home strategy: are you committed to one brand’s vision, or do you want the freedom to mix and match? In 2026, the trend favors interoperable hubs, but proprietary systems often deliver more nuanced blind control features.
Integration Depth: Beyond Basic Open/Close Commands
Surface-level integration might let you open and close blinds, but deep integration transforms how you interact with your entire home. This is where premium systems justify their cost.
Granular Position Control and Scene Setting
Look for systems that support percentage-based positioning (e.g., “set blinds to 45%”) and can save complex scenes combining multiple rooms. The best integrations allow you to specify blind tilt angles for horizontal slats independently of lift position, enabling precise light management without sacrificing privacy.
Scheduling and Automation Synergy
Advanced voice assistants don’t just respond to commands—they anticipate needs based on environmental data. Integration with weather services can automatically close blinds during intense sun to reduce cooling costs. Syncing with your calendar might mean opening blinds 15 minutes before your first video call for optimal lighting. Evaluate the automation engine’s sophistication: can it create conditional logic based on time, weather, occupancy, and manual overrides?

Installation and Setup Considerations
The best technology fails if installation is problematic. Voice-controlled blind systems have unique installation requirements that differ from other smart home devices.
Professional vs. DIY Integration
While many systems advertise DIY-friendliness, blind integration often involves electrical wiring, precise motor calibration, and network optimization. Professional installers bring expertise in signal strength mapping and can program complex scenes that account for window orientation, seasonal sun paths, and furniture placement. Factor installation costs into your budget—typically 15-25% of the hardware cost.
Wiring and Power Requirements
Voice-controlled blinds need consistent power, either through low-voltage wiring or rechargeable batteries. In 2026, solar-powered options with micro-harvesting technology have matured, but they require sufficient daily light exposure. Hubs also have power needs: some require permanent electrical connections, while others use Power over Ethernet (PoE) for cleaner installations. Plan your power infrastructure before purchasing.

Troubleshooting Common Voice Control Issues
Even the best systems encounter problems. Understanding common failure points helps you evaluate support quality and system resilience.
Network Congestion and Command Failures
Blind motors in far corners of your home may struggle with weak signals. Mesh network quality matters more than raw internet speed. Look for hubs with network diagnostic tools that map signal strength and suggest repeater placement. Systems that fallback to Bluetooth when Wi-Fi fails provide crucial redundancy.
Voice Recognition in Noisy Environments
Kitchens with running water, rooms with TVs, or homes near busy streets challenge voice recognition. Advanced assistants use beamforming microphone arrays and noise cancellation algorithms. Test systems in your actual environment during the return window—some perform dramatically better with ambient noise than others.
Frequently Asked Questions
Will voice-controlled blinds work with my existing manual blinds, or do I need completely new window treatments?
Most systems in 2026 are designed to retrofit existing blinds rather than replace them entirely. Motorization kits can adapt to roller shades, Venetian blinds, vertical blinds, and even cellular shades. The key is measuring your specific blind type and ensuring the motor’s torque matches your blinds’ weight and size. Some premium systems integrate directly into new blind headrails for a cleaner look, but retrofit solutions have become remarkably sophisticated and visually discreet.
What happens to my blinds if my internet connection goes down?
This depends entirely on your hub’s architecture. Systems with robust local processing continue to respond to voice commands via your home network, though remote access and cloud-based automation pause until connectivity returns. Basic open/close commands typically work offline, but advanced natural language features may degrade. Battery-powered blinds generally maintain their last position during outages. Always test offline functionality during your setup period and configure critical automations to run locally.
How secure are voice assistants that are always listening for blind commands?
Security has improved dramatically with 2026’s hardware-based encryption standards, but risks remain. The most secure systems process wake-word detection locally and only transmit audio after activation. Look for assistants with physical microphone disconnect switches and transparent data policies that allow you to delete voice recordings automatically. For maximum privacy, position assistants away from windows and sensitive areas, and use push-button voice controllers in bedrooms where always-listening devices feel intrusive.
Can I control different rooms independently, or do all blinds move together?
Modern systems offer room-level, zone-level, and even individual blind control. You can group blinds by room (“close the bedroom blinds”), by function (“close all blackout blinds”), or control them individually (“close the kitchen window blind to 30%”). Advanced setups allow overlapping groups—a “west side” group might include blinds from multiple rooms that all face the same direction for coordinated sun management. The limitation is usually your hub’s processing power, not the voice assistant itself.

Can renters install voice-controlled blinds without permanent modifications?
Absolutely. The rental market has driven innovation in non-permanent solutions. Battery-powered motors with adhesive-mounted brackets require no drilling and leave no damage. Some hubs use cellular connectivity, eliminating the need to access router settings. Voice assistants can be freestanding units rather than hardwired. Always check your lease agreement, but most landlords approve blind upgrades that improve energy efficiency and don’t alter the property permanently.
How steep is the learning curve for elderly users or those uncomfortable with technology?
Voice control actually lowers the barrier to entry compared to smartphone apps. Most systems support simple, memorable commands and can be programmed with custom phrases like “sunshine” or “privacy mode.” The key is initial setup and training—spending time teaching the system the user’s voice and preferences pays dividends. Some systems offer “companion mode” with simplified command sets and visual feedback through LED indicators. Physical remote controls as backup provide confidence for users hesitant to rely solely on voice.
What maintenance do voice-controlled blind systems require?
Unlike manual blinds, smart systems need periodic attention. Motors may require battery replacement or lubrication every 2-3 years. Hubs need firmware updates—enable automatic updates but review changelogs for breaking changes. Voice assistants benefit from occasional retraining to maintain accuracy as voices age. Dust and debris can affect motor performance, so annual cleaning of headrails is recommended. Most quality systems include diagnostic modes that proactively alert you to maintenance needs before failures occur.
